Course Description
Third clinical practicum with focus on increased autonomy and patient panel management. Students function at near-independent level with preceptor oversight, managing complex patients and developing practice efficiency.

Procedure Competencies
- Suturing and wound care
- Joint injections
- Pap smears and pelvic exams
- Incision and drainage
- Skin biopsies
